What You'll Do

As a CHW, you'll drive real impact in our community by:

  • Educating the public about opioid overdose prevention and how to use naloxone (Narcan)
  • Distributing FDA-approved overdose reversal medications and materials
  • Connecting with individuals who use opioids or have been affected by overdose-including families and support networks
  • Driving the Mobile Unit to outreach events, health fairs, and underserved areas
  • Representing SPBH at community events and promoting access to MAR services
  • Tracking outreach activities and maintaining accurate records for reporting

Why This Role Matters

This is not a clinical or case management role-it's about being present in the community, sharing resources, and creating connections. Everything you do helps build a healthier, safer community where more people can access the help they need-at no cost to them.
